About The Position

Join McDonald's as our Director, LIOM Customer Technology, and contribute to crafting the future of digital commerce solutions! You will guide the preparation of the next generation digital commerce solution. It will first launch in France and later expand to all IOM/IDL markets. This role offers a highly multifaceted setting where you will collaborate with teams from various markets and global technology partners. The purpose of the role: Accountable for the long-term strategy for software, hardware, and architecture that prepares for the future and works towards standardization between markets. Manage and optimize the strategy and communication link between global engineering and markets. Ensure product and market estate readiness for digital technology platforms including Mobile Apps, Digital offers, Kiosk, Home Delivery, Dedication Programs, Digital Back-end capabilities, and Data. Responsible for building and sustaining connections with markets, Global Technology, Segment Teams, strategic partners like Capgemini, Umain, and other internal groups including DCE, Legal, and Operations. Effective communication and influencing skills are crucial. A keen eye for detail, a thoughtful approach, and the capacity to rapidly pinpoint the underlying cause of issues will be crucial for success in the role. Hands-on troubleshooting and engagement on requirements, issues, and remediation approaches, as warranted.

Requirements

  • Extensive experience in strategic project management, business analysis, and working in ambiguous environments to identify, define, and implement change.
  • Shown ability to deliver clear and succinct information, facilitating rapid and informed decision-making within the organization.
  • Proven knowledge in Digital and Retail Technology, encompassing Mobile Apps, e-commerce, Self-Order Kiosks, POS, and Home Delivery systems.
  • Strong project management skills with a preference for PMP or other certifications, and exposure to Agile methodologies.
  • Outstanding talent for connecting with and motivating culturally teams with varied strengths in a global, product-centric organization.

Responsibilities

  • Strategic Leadership: Lead the LIOM Segment Technology Team as Digital Director – Solution Services, supporting key markets (UK, Germany, Canada, Australia, and France) to deliver better customer experiences and embrace global technology solutions. Find opportunities for efficiency and drive continuous improvement.
  • Teamwork and Partnership: Partner daily with colleagues across various teams, including Product Engineering, Architecture Services, Project Management Office, and Global Release Managers, as well as Global Strategic Technology Partners, to prepare and deploy new digital solutions into markets effectively.
  • Product and Market Preparation: Ensure readiness for digital technology platforms, including Mobile Apps, Digital offers, Kiosk, Home Delivery, Dedication Programs, Digital Back-end capabilities, and Data. Build and sustain connections with Markets, Global Technology, Strategic partners, and other internal functions.
  • Problem Solving: Demonstrate attention to detail, forward-looking critical thinking, and a problem-solving analytical approach on sophisticated initiatives to deliver the best experience to our markets in a supported partnership.
